Job description

Customer Support & Sales Administrator - Galway

Production Equipment UC is a leading industrial distributor supplying over 90,000 products to customers domestically and across Europe. We are looking for someone to play an important role supporting our private label brands division, provide frontline customer service to our distributor network, coordinate logistics for incoming stock and outgoing orders, drive brand growth, and support the increase of new business.

As an experienced Customer Support professional you will be tasked with building strong customer relationships as well as fostering good internal rapport with all relevant teams and business units to deliver excellent service level and product support to our clients. The ability to operate in a fast paced and demanding environment is essential.

Responsibilities
  • Develop good business relationships with new and existing customers.
  • Work closely with internal and external colleagues to ensure customer service excellence is delivered.
  • Process customer requests and enquiries quickly and accurately to ensure timely delivery.
  • Deal with frontline customer enquiries by web, phone and email.
  • Coordinate delivery and transport method for shipments to customers.
  • Monitor open orders and follow-up internally with production & procurement teams to ensure no delays.
  • Inform customers on the technical benefits of our products and support the resolution of technical queries.
  • Support the increase of business by maximising sales & up-selling to each customer where possible
  • Regularly analyse sales data and new requests to ensure no drop off in business, or conflicts with existing business.
  • Assist with marketing activities to support brand recognition and sales growth.
  • Coordinate closely with senior stakeholders on day-to-day opportunities and sales strategies.
Skills & Experience
  • Experience in a similar customer facing role.
  • Ability to identify customer needs and maximise sales opportunities.
  • Confidence to learn and discuss the benefits & technical features of our products.
  • Experience with international shipments and dealing across multiple jurisdictions / geographies
  • Strong communication, organisational and administration skills.
  • Flexible and Pro-active attitude.
  • Ability to embrace new ideas / initiatives when they arise.
  • Technical or Marketing background/qualification is a distinct advantage.
  • Desire to deliver first class customer service.
  • Experience of SAP or a similar ERP system.
  • Good Microsoft Office skills, in particular Excel.
